## Overview

OpenAI published a promotional article describing how enterprises are transitioning from using AI for assistance to full execution tasks, positioning itself as the enabling platform for this shift.

### TL;DR

- OpenAI frames enterprise AI adoption as moving beyond chatbots toward autonomous task execution.
- The article highlights unnamed enterprise use cases without verifiable metrics or independent validation.
- It presents OpenAI's technology as central to this evolution without disclosing limitations, failure modes, or comparative benchmarks.

## Narrative Mechanics

**Function:** signal_momentum  

### The Spin in Plain English

The article doesn’t prove enterprises are executing tasks autonomously with AI — it declares that they are, using confident language and forward-looking verbs to make the trend feel both current and unstoppable.

**What the story wants you to believe:** That AI has already crossed a threshold into autonomous enterprise execution — and OpenAI is the platform powering that shift.  

**What it makes harder to question:** Whether this 'execution' phase is real, safe, or widely adopted — because the framing treats it as an observed fact rather than a contested claim.  

**How the Spin Works:** It combines vague aggregation ('100+ enterprises'), loaded terminology ('execution', 'autonomous'), and virtue-signaling ('responsible scaling') to create a sense of inevitability — while offering zero evidence of actual deployment fidelity, error containment, or regulatory alignment, making the claimed capability feel larger and more mature than the support provided.

## Reader Risk

**Evidence Strength:** low  
No named enterprises, no verifiable case studies, no metrics on task success rates, latency, or error handling; all claims are anecdotal or aggregated without sourcing.  
**Verification Status:** Unclear / Unverified  
**Narrative Risk:** moderate  
If early adopters publicly report failures in 'execution' mode — e.g., erroneous financial transactions or unapproved system changes — the 'future-is-here' framing could appear premature or misleading, triggering credibility loss.  
**AI Repetition Risk:** high  
**What AI Will Probably Repeat:** Enterprises are now using AI to autonomously execute business tasks, not just assist — led by OpenAI.  
AI systems will likely drop qualifiers like 'claimed', 'unverified', or 'anonymized', presenting the transition as empirically established rather than narratively asserted.  
**Counter-Frame (Media):** Media may reframe this as 'marketing-as-reporting' — highlighting absence of named customers, measurable outcomes, or third-party corroboration.  
**Missing Voices:** Enterprise IT operations leads, AI safety auditors, Affected end-users (e.g., customers receiving AI-executed service), Competing platform providers  

### Questions Not Answered

- Which specific enterprises? What tasks are fully executed? What error rates, fallback protocols, or human oversight mechanisms exist?
- How does OpenAI’s offering compare to alternatives (e.g., Anthropic, Microsoft Copilot, open-source models)?
- What contractual, liability, or compliance frameworks govern these 'execution' deployments?
